In Robert Burns, John Campbell Shairp keeps the focus on what a person becomes under pressure.

It is interested in what is left after pride, temptation, fear, and comfort have had their say.

The prose stays clear while leaving room for reflection.

If you like classics that feel psychologically close, this is a strong pick.

This is a good book to read slowly, then think about later.
